Across TCGA patient cohorts, ACSBG1 RNA expression is significantly associated with the protein abundance of many other proteins, with 7,159 significant associations in total. GBM shows the largest number of these associations.

The most reproducible ACSBG1-associated proteins across cancer lineages are MYH9_S1943, TJP1, and EEF2_T59. Each is linked with ACSBG1 in more than 2 cancer types. Because this analysis shows association rather than direction, both ACSBG1-to-partner and partner-to-ACSBG1 results are reported.

Each partner links to its own Q-omics profile. The scatter plot shows the strongest example, ACSBG1 versus MYH9_S1943 in GBM, with a Pearson correlation of -0.31.
